dc.descriptionIt is increasingly recognized that effectively enforced environmental law is critical to attaining the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). However, the SDG global indicator framework, as approved by the UN General Assembly in 2017, has generally overlooked environment specific legal indicators, undermining the role of environmental law in achieving the SDGs. This paper explores ways to foster the use of the suggested indicators for furthering the implementation of SDGs having direct bearing on the legal protection of the environment. This entails refinements to the SDG global indicator framework, conceivably involving the addition of new indicators or the revision of current indicators with a view to advancing the realization of environment-related SDGs.en
